Logan hosts hundreds of coal miners for coal mine rescue competition

Summary by WOWK
LOGAN, W.Va. (WOWK) - Hundreds of coal miners from five states are competing in a coal mine rescue competition at Chief Logan State Park. The miners competing came from West Virginia, Pennsylvania, Ohio, Kentucky and Alabama to participate in the Fallen Heroes Mine Rescue Contest.
